Somwarpet, Jan 27: Union Minister Ananth Kumar Hegde, who is known for controversial statements, yet again sparked a row on Sunday after he explained how to keep “Hindu girls safe.” Hegde said that the hands which “touch” Hindu girls, should be “chopped off” and “cease to exist.”

The BJP leader was speaking at the inauguration of a temple at Kallukore of Madapura in communally sensitive Somwarpet taluk. The temple was damaged during the recent natural calamity.

In a contentious statement, Hegde said, “There should be a fundamental shift in our thinking. We should keenly observe what's happening around us. Regardless of caste and religion, a hand that touches a Hindu girl should not exist. History is written like that.”

Meanwhile, during his speech on Sunday, Hegde also claimed that the Taj Mahal in Agra was not built by Muslims and that it was a "Shiv mandir called Tejo Mahalaya." He said, "Taj Mahal was not built by Muslims. It's definitely not built by Muslims, the history speaks for it. Shah Jahan in his autobiography has said he bought this palace from King Jayasimha. It's a Shiv mandir built by King Paramatheertha, Tejo Mahalaya. Tejo Mahalaya became Taj Mahal. If we keep sleeping, most of our houses also will be named manzil. In future, Lord Ram will be called jahanpana and Sita will become bibi."

On the other hand, Karnataka Congress president Dinesh Gundu Rao slammed Hegde for his controversial remarks, calling them “deplorable.” Gundu Rao tweeted, “Wht are ur achievements after becoming a Union Minister or as MP? Wht are ur contributions for Karnataka's development? All I can say for sure, it's deplorable tht such people have become ministers & have managed to get elected as MP's.(sic)”

In the past as well, Hegde has waded into controversies after making inappropriate statements on sensitive issues. Earlier this month, the Union Minister had claimed that the handling of the Sabarimala issue by the Kerala government was the "daylight rape" of Hindus.

Last year, Hegde's statement had lowered the political discourse in Karnataka after he compared members of the Opposition parties to animals such as "crows, monkeys, foxes, and donkeys", slamming them for "coming together" to take on the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) in the upcoming elections.

In 2017, he had generated a sparked off a massive debate after criticising the word "secular" and claiming that the BJP government would "amend the Constitution" to remove the word from the Constitution's Preamble. “Seculars do not know what their blood is. Yes Constitution has given that right to say 'we are secular' but Constitution has been amended many times, we will also amend it. We have come to power for that,” Hegde had said.

Tumkuru, Feb 26: A man was arrested from Azad Nagar area of Anantpur on Wednesday for making derogatory remarks against Prophet Mohammed and posting it on social media earlier this month, police said.

He was identified as Atul Kumar alias Madhugiri Modi, a resident of Madhugiri’s Hobali Honnapur village.

According to Superintendent of Police Vamshikrishna teams had been formed to arrest the accused following protests against his video and remarks against Prophet Mohammed in Tumkuru and Madhugiri,

Bengaluru, June 23: A frustrated chartered accountant has committed suicide after killing his wife and mother-in-law in two different cities of India.

The murder-murder-suicide came amid acrimonious divorce proceedings that might have also involved a property dispute, police said.

Amit flew to Bengaluru last weekend to kill his estranged wife at her Whitefield residence before returning to Kolkata, where he shot dead his mother-in-law and then killed himself at an upscale residential complex in North Kolkata on Monday evening.

Amit and his wife Shilpi Agarwal, who is also a CA, had been living separately since last the two years after their marriage turned sour.

Amit took his 10-year-old son from Bengaluru with him on Monday and dropped him at his uncle’s house before heading to his in-laws’ place Phoolbagan, police said.

Neighbours told cops they heard arguments “appeared to be” over some property documents that Amit wanted his in-laws — 70-year-old Subhas and 62-year-old Lalita Dhandhania — to sign.

The first gunshot was heard a little before 6.30pm, following which Subhas ran out of his flat, bolted the door from outside and took refuge inside his next-door neighbour’s apartment. Police arrived a few minutes later to find Amit and his mother-in-law dead. Police found a suicide note from the flat.

Mangaluru, Mar 22: A 22-year-old man from Bhatkal who had returned from Dubai on March 19 has tested positive for coronavirus.

Sindhu B Rupesh, Deputy Commissioner of Dakshina Kannada confrimed this today.

The youth, after landing at Mangaluru International Airport had got admitted to Govt Wenlock Hospital.

The total number of coronavirus positive patients in India rose to 342 on Sunday, as per the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R).

A total of 16,999 samples from 16,109 individuals have been tested for COVID-19 as of 10:00 am on March 22, as per ICMR data.

India reported two deaths today from the highly contagious virus - one each in Maharashtra and Bihar - taking the tally to six, as per state authorities.
